Secret Differences In Between Therapies



When it involves acne treatments, recognizing the crucial distinctions can make a considerable effect on your skin's health.

You'll locate 2 main groups: over-the-counter (OTC) and prescription therapies. OTC options, such as benzoyl peroxide and salicylic acid, are conveniently offered and have a tendency to be less intensive. They usually function by unclogging pores and decreasing swelling, making them suitable for moderate to moderate acne.

On the other hand, prescription treatments generally consist of more powerful active ingredients, like retinoids or antibiotics, and are customized for extra serious instances. These treatments typically require a skin doctor's advice, enabling them to target details skin issues effectively.

The stamina and formulation of prescription options can lead to quicker results but might likewise include a higher risk of negative effects.

You need to additionally consider your skin kind and any type of sensitivities when selecting a therapy. For instance, if you have sensitive skin, OTC treatments may be a gentler starting factor.

Inevitably, understanding these distinctions helps you make educated options regarding your acne treatment trip and leads you toward clearer skin.

Pros and Cons of Prescription Choices



Prescription options for acne treatment included both benefits and disadvantages that you ought to weigh meticulously.

One significant pro is their effectiveness. Prescription drugs often contain higher concentrations of active ingredients, which can bring about faster and more efficient outcomes contrasted to over-the-counter (OTC) items. You could additionally find that prescriptions are tailored to your certain skin type and acne intensity, providing a much more individualized method.



On the flip side, these treatments can come with substantial disadvantages. For one, they might have adverse effects varying from moderate irritability to more major complications, which you need to keep an eye on closely.

Additionally, prescription treatments can be extra costly, especially if your insurance doesn't cover them. You could additionally face challenges in obtaining a prescription, as it needs a visit to a healthcare provider, which can be taxing and troublesome.
